I know it's a bit late, but here are some Christmas names I thought you all might like to read about!
One of the most obvious is Noel/Noelle, which means Christmas in French. If you believe in the real meaning of Christmas, and the reason for the season, (Jesus's Birthday!) Mary is a good name, and so is Josef or Joseph. Mary could also be used as in 'Merry Christmas', and you could choose to spell it Meri or Merry, or maybe even Mari.
Then Nicholas, ofcourse, which is for a boy. St.Nick/Nicholas is what Santa Claus is also called/reffered to. For a girl, or even for a boy, you could shorten the name to Nicki/Nicky.
Also, Emerald might be a nice and girly choice for a baby born around Christmas time, or if you are just wanting to honor the Holiday season in your child's name, because Emerald is green. And as we all know, Green is often used as a "Christmas Color".
Most of us know that part of the Christmas story took place in Bethlehem, where you can get a great name from this place, particulary a girl's name. Anyone know what it is? ...
It's BETH. Beth is a sweet sounding name, and simple. It's easy to spell, and it doesn't usually have any mis-pronounciations. It's also a good name if you don't want the connection to be as obvious as say, naming your child Noel.

To start off, I will post a short list of name meanings, 3 boys & 3 girl's names..
Olivia- Meaning: Olive Tree. Origin: Latin
Chloe- Meaning: Young Green Shoot. Origin: Greek
Beatrice- Meaning: Blessed, She Who Brings Happiness. Origin: Latin
Soren- Meaning: Stern. Origin: Scandanavian
Axel- Meaning: Father Of Peace. Origin: German
Alexander- Meaning: Defending Warrior. Origin: Greek
